Selecting a treadmill appropriate for your needs will require some thought about the features you're looking for as well as the amount of space you have to store it. For example, some treadmills can fold flat to make storage space while others come with more traditional shapes that takes up more floor area. Be aware of your budget, as models cost a bit different based on the features that they provide.

Stability is an important factor when choosing a treadmill that folds. You'll be running at a high speed, so you must ensure that the machine is stable enough to run on without causing injury. You must also think about the place you'll put the treadmill since certain models tend to bounce around when you use them. This could cause you to fall and injure yourself.

The size of the running deck could also impact the amount of space you have to work out in. Experts recommend that you measure the space in which you're planning to place your treadmill, so you can be confident that it will be able to fit. It is important to measure the area where you intend to put your treadmill, particularly in the case of a high-end model. It would be frustrating if your treadmill didn't fit.

You can get more from your workout by adjusting the intensity and pace. You can incorporate interval training and hill workouts into your training.

HIIT workouts are a popular training trend that can help you increase your energy levels and accelerate progress towards your fitness goals. While you can do HIIT exercises on any piece of equipment (think bodyweight intervals, Tabata, and Boot Camp-style workouts) treadmills are an ideal tool to incorporate these intense workouts.

The best treadmills for HIIT workouts come with settings that let you quickly switch between walking and jogging speed, as well as increasing and decreasing the incline. Look for treadmills that can attain an incline of up to 15% and responds to changes in speed and incline increases with a fast, smooth response.

A quality treadmill should include a quiet motor, deck and other components to reduce the sound of your steps and create a simulated running experience. It should include a range of exercises and a display showing your speed as well as distance and time.

If you are planning to do a lot of walking or light jogging, you can save some money by buying an exercise machine with smaller running surfaces and a weaker motor. But if you plan to push yourself with more strenuous jogging or speed, you must choose a treadmill that can handle the added power. Before making a purchase make sure to check the treadmill's peak and continuous horsepower. The peak horsepower might be more impressive, but because treadmills aren't operating at their maximum capacity continuously and continuously, continuous horsepower is the most important number.
